What is a Zone Lift Kit?
A Zone lift kit is a suspension modification designed to elevate a vehicle's body and chassis higher off the ground, primarily to accommodate larger tires and improve off-road performance. Zone Offroad is recognized for offering robust and cost-effective lift solutions for a variety of trucks and SUVs, often focusing on specific lift heights like 4-inch systems that strike a balance between substantial clearance and drivability.

Core Principles of Zone Lift Kits
The primary goal of any lift kit, including those from Zone Offroad, is to raise the vehicle's frame and body away from the axles and suspension components. This increased space allows for the fitment of larger diameter tires, which in turn provides greater ground clearance over obstacles encountered off-road. Beyond tire size, these kits often incorporate components that address suspension geometry changes, ensuring that steering, suspension travel, and braking remain safe and functional.
Essential Components and Their Function
A typical Zone lift kit, particularly a 4-inch system, includes a series of engineered parts. This commonly involves taller coil springs or spacers for the front suspension and either new springs or blocks for the rear. Crucially, many kits also feature longer-travel or replacement shock absorbers, extended brake lines to accommodate the increased suspension droop, and sometimes sway bar links or drop brackets to maintain proper suspension alignment and geometry. Practical Applications and Installation Considerations
Maximizing Off-Road Capability
When you opt for a Zone lift kit, you're typically seeking to transform your vehicle for more demanding terrains. The increased ground clearance is vital for clearing rocks, logs, and uneven surfaces that would otherwise bottom out a stock vehicle. This elevation also improves the approach, departure, and breakover angles, allowing you to tackle steeper inclines and declines with greater confidence. Zone Lift Kit Installation Process
Installing a Zone lift kit is a complex procedure that demands significant mechanical expertise. It involves safely lifting the vehicle, removing existing suspension components, and installing the new, taller parts. This often includes extending or replacing brake lines, potentially modifying the exhaust system, and ensuring all steering and suspension linkages are correctly reconnected and torqued. Maintenance and Troubleshooting
Routine Maintenance for Lifted Vehicles
After installing a Zone lift kit, routine maintenance becomes even more critical. Your vehicle's suspension, steering, and drivetrain components are under increased stress. Regularly inspect all hardware for tightness, check rubber bushings for wear or cracking, and examine brake lines and ABS sensor wires for damage. Wheel alignment should be checked periodically, especially after encountering significant impacts or if you notice uneven tire wear. Proper maintenance ensures longevity and safety, extending the life of both the lift components and your vehicle's original parts.
Common Issues and Solutions
One common issue after lifting is driveline vibration, particularly if the lift height significantly alters the angle of the driveshaft. This can often be resolved with shims or by adjusting the pinion angle. Steering components, like tie rods and ball joints, may experience accelerated wear due to altered geometry; regular checks are essential. Binding or limited suspension travel can occur if components like sway bar links or shocks are not properly extended or replaced. Troubleshooting Alignment and Tire Wear
If you experience pulling to one side or rapid, uneven tire wear, it's a clear sign your alignment needs adjustment. A proper alignment after lifting accounts for the modified suspension geometry.
